ECU in 323???Where is it?

Allright guys there's someone in my town that wants to buy the SOHC 1.8 out of my pro for $750 after i put my KL-ZE in (hopefully really soon ). A few months ago i was driving around and happen to see a parked 90-94 323 lx with 3 flats and a little bit of rear end damage (this was before i knew what i know now about the differences between the pro and 323) so i asked the guy if he wanted to sell it 'cus it just sits there (thinking that it may be a GTX or something also before i knew they didn't sell 'em in the US). So he tells me that he'll sell it to me for $250 bucks, it needs a radiator and tires. So now about 4 months later i'm gonna buy the car offa this guy and turn it into a drag car. Finally what i need to know is how hard is it to take out the ECU and where its located. I think that's with the engine

It's behind the radio, you can get at it from both the passenger and driver's footwell (you might have to do both to get it out.) Basically there's just a screw or two and you pop a panel out to see it.
